This makes me laugh. Not only is IsleOfWeather bang on with what they said but the fact that people even discuss the ratings shows that Big Brother is still doing it's job! And if you're going to make the effort to come and post on a forum about a show then obviously you havn't lost interest in the show.

For a show that's on 7 days a week the viewing figures are more than adequate to justify channel 4 keeping Big Brother. The show is all over the net, watched online, in the papers, magazines, talked about on other shows...etc.

It keeps Channel4 in the spotlight in so many ways that viewing figures just aren't as important as some people like to make out.
